How well do COVID antivirals actually work? Not as well as we thought
NicolasMcComber/Getty Images If you’re aged over 70, or over 50 with underlying health conditions, and have tested positive for COVID, you might have been offered free or subsidised antivirals. Earlier in the pandemic, these medicines were an important way to reduce the chance of people becoming severely ill with COVID, needing to be hospitalised, or dying. But our new research suggests that with high levels of vaccination and immunity from previous infections, COVID antivirals are no longer…
